Targa Newfoundland Unveils Full Sponsor Ecosystem, Announces Lives Showcase at IBC 2026 Amsterdam

By: Business Wire

Add as a preferred source on Google

Targa Newfoundland today announced the full sponsor lineup powering the rally’s 25th anniversary livestream, the first in the event’s history, alongside a live showcase of the broadcast at IBC 2026 in Amsterdam. For the first time, North America’s only tarmac rally will stream live and free on YouTube, made possible by an ecosystem of ten presenting and technology sponsors led by official connectivity partner, Dejero.

“This broadcast doesn’t happen without the partners who believed we could pull it off,” said Robert Giannou, Founder of Targa Newfoundland. “Two thousand kilometres of the most remote roads in Newfoundland are about to be seen by the entire world, for the first time in 25 years.”

The 2026 broadcast is powered by a full ecosystem of sponsors, each contributing a piece of the connectivity, production, and distribution chain required to stream live from Newfoundland’s most isolated terrain:

Presenting Sponsors

  • Dejero: Blended connectivity
  • Eutelsat: Satellite provider
  • Intel and ADLINK Technology: Edge compute

Technology Sponsors

  • BLiNQ Networks: Private 5G fronthaul
  • GlobalM: Video distribution
  • Grabyo: Cloud production
  • Jetwerx: Live stream broadcast production
  • Matrox Video: Encoding and distribution
  • Network Innovations: Connectivity integrator

“No single technology could solve this alone,” said Kevin Fernandes, Chief Revenue Officer at Dejero. “It took an ecosystem of partners, each solving a different piece of the puzzle, to bring a live signal out of terrain that’s never carried one before.”

About Dejero
Driven by its vision of reliable connectivity anywhere, Dejero delivers real-time video and networking solutions that provide resilient, uninterrupted internet connectivity for critical communications. Powered by intelligent network aggregation technology, Dejero combines diverse telecommunication networks including 4G/5G cellular, GEO/MEO/LEO satellite, and fixed broadband, to create a software-defined ‘network of networks’ managed in the cloud. The result is enhanced reliability, expanded coverage, and greater bandwidth for its global customers. Founded in 2008, privately-held Dejero is headquartered in Waterloo, Ontario, Canada.
